PHP Класс WoohooLabs\Yin\JsonApi\Document\AbstractCollectionDocument

Наследование: extends AbstractSuccessfulDocument
Показать файл Открыть проект

Защищенные свойства (Protected)

Свойство Тип Описание
$transformer WoohooLabs\Yin\JsonApi\Transformer\ResourceTransformerInterface

Открытые методы

Метод Описание
__construct ( WoohooLabs\Yin\JsonApi\Transformer\ResourceTransformerInterface $transformer )

Защищенные методы

Метод Описание
createData ( )
fillData ( Transformation $transformation )
getItems ( )
getRelationshipContent ( $relationshipName, Transformation $transformation, array $additionalMeta = [] )
hasItems ( )

Описание методов

__construct() публичный Метод

public __construct ( WoohooLabs\Yin\JsonApi\Transformer\ResourceTransformerInterface $transformer )
$transformer WoohooLabs\Yin\JsonApi\Transformer\ResourceTransformerInterface

createData() защищенный Метод

protected createData ( )

fillData() защищенный Метод

protected fillData ( Transformation $transformation )
$transformation WoohooLabs\Yin\JsonApi\Transformer\Transformation

getItems() защищенный Метод

protected getItems ( )

getRelationshipContent() защищенный Метод

protected getRelationshipContent ( $relationshipName, Transformation $transformation, array $additionalMeta = [] )
$transformation WoohooLabs\Yin\JsonApi\Transformer\Transformation
$additionalMeta array

hasItems() защищенный Метод

protected hasItems ( )

Описание свойств

$transformer защищенное свойство

protected ResourceTransformerInterface,WoohooLabs\Yin\JsonApi\Transformer $transformer
Результат WoohooLabs\Yin\JsonApi\Transformer\ResourceTransformerInterface